本文目录导读:
在信息化时代,文件系统和数据库系统作为两种重要的数据存储和管理方式,各有千秋,同时也存在诸多联系,本文将从文件系统和数据库系统的定义、特点、应用场景等方面进行分析,旨在揭示二者之间的差异与交融。
定义与特点
1、文件系统
图片来源于网络,如有侵权联系删除
文件系统是一种用于存储、管理和检索数据的基本软件,它将计算机中的数据组织成文件,通过文件名、路径等标识符来访问,文件系统具有以下特点:
(1)简单易用:文件系统的操作简单,用户只需通过文件名和路径即可访问所需数据。
(2)数据结构单一:文件系统通常采用线性结构,数据之间没有复杂的关系。
(3)安全性较低:文件系统的安全性相对较低,易受到病毒、恶意软件等攻击。
2、数据库系统
数据库系统是一种用于存储、管理和检索大量数据的软件,它将数据组织成表,通过SQL等查询语言进行操作,数据库系统具有以下特点:
(1)结构化:数据库系统采用关系模型,数据之间具有复杂的关系,便于数据管理和查询。
(2)安全性高:数据库系统具有完善的权限管理、备份、恢复等功能,安全性较高。
(3)可扩展性强:数据库系统支持大量数据的存储和管理,可满足不同规模的数据需求。
应用场景
1、文件系统
图片来源于网络,如有侵权联系删除
文件系统适用于以下场景:
(1)数据量较小:当数据量不大时,文件系统操作简单,易于维护。
(2)对数据安全性要求不高:如个人文档、图片等数据,对安全性要求不高,使用文件系统即可。
(3)单机应用:对于单机应用,文件系统可以满足数据存储和管理的需求。
2、数据库系统
数据库系统适用于以下场景:
(1)数据量较大:当数据量较大时,数据库系统可以高效地存储、管理和查询数据。
(2)对数据安全性、可靠性要求较高:如企业内部管理系统、电子商务平台等,对数据安全性、可靠性要求较高,使用数据库系统更为合适。
(3)多用户、多应用场景:数据库系统支持多用户同时访问,适用于多应用场景。
差异与交融
1、差异
图片来源于网络,如有侵权联系删除
(1)数据结构:文件系统采用线性结构,数据库系统采用关系模型。
(2)安全性:文件系统安全性较低,数据库系统安全性较高。
(3)扩展性:文件系统可扩展性较差,数据库系统可扩展性较强。
2、交融
(1)数据存储:文件系统和数据库系统均可用于存储数据,但数据库系统在存储大量数据方面更具优势。
(2)数据管理:文件系统和数据库系统均可用于数据管理,但数据库系统在数据管理方面功能更为丰富。
(3)数据查询:文件系统和数据库系统均可用于数据查询,但数据库系统在数据查询方面更为高效。
文件系统和数据库系统在数据存储、管理和查询等方面存在诸多差异,但它们之间也存在一定的交融,在实际应用中,应根据具体需求选择合适的数据存储和管理方式,以实现数据的高效、安全、可靠存储。
标签: #简述文件系统和数据库系统之间的区别和联系
评论列表